Fletcher Building has signalled a small downside bias in its core operating profit forecast for the year ending June 2020. The guidance, which ranges from a 6 percent reduction to a 3 percent increase from last year, comes as its New Zealand building products businesses are on track, wet weather has slowed Higgins' work, and the Australian operations face intense competition in a declining residential market and where infrastructure projects are delayed.
